Transaction 63ade10648a87bb54f6c2b5a73a90055c112195b20118d33c34299ea1dfa5276
1 Input
1 Output
-
63ade10648a87bb54f6c2b5a73a90055c112195b20118d33c34299ea1dfa5276:0
- value
- 893066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5f1045df8119a286fdcd5fde2665364952c5ae2 OP_EQUAL
- address
- 3JH2xRYDSqQeoUdLk2JoMKnPbGGwnuV5BW